Attach the Hitch Bike Rack to Your Vehicle

Before you start installing the bike to your rack, ensure the rack you have is the right one for your vehicle. Use the sleeve adaptor to insert your hitch bolt to your rack hitch tube.

Adjust the trays or support arms and lock them into place using the provided safety pins. If you have any trouble mounting your rack to your vehicle, you can contact your manufacturer or find relevant information on YouTube.

Put Your Bikes on the Hitch

Carry your bike and place it on the supporting arms of the hitch bike rack carefully. There are those racks that carry two bikes while others can carry even more. If you are carrying two or more bikes, put one bike at a time while securing them.

There are different ways of securing bikes on racks. These include; adjustable clamps, rubber tie-downs, and Velcro tie-downs. Use the wheel ties for more safety.

After fastening the first one, you can add the rest one at a time while fastening them.

Test If Everything is Working Properly

Now that you have successfully put your bike on the hitch rack, you should take a short drive to see if everything is working correctly. This step is necessary before you head for long distances with your bike.

If you don’t want to risk your bike, you should first drive around with the hitch rack on your vehicle. If it is right then now you can add the bikes.

If you test and everything is good, then you are good to go.
